Dynamics of charge excitations in the NaV2O5 spin ladder system - experiment and theory. — •M. S. Golden1, S. Atzkern1, M. Knupfer1, J. Fink1, A. N. Yaresko2, V. N. Antonov2, A. Huebsch3, C. We present a joint experimental and theoretical investigation of the dynamics of the charge excitations in the spin ladder system NaV2O5 measured using high resolution electron energy-loss in transmission. The optical conductivities derived from the loss data were compared to LSDA+U calculations, allowing an estimation of U. Additionally, the q-dependent loss functions were simulated within an effective 16-V-site cluster model, indicating both the validity of the hopping parameters derived from a tight binding fit to the bandstructure and the presence of moderate Coulomb interactions between the electrons within the ab plane.
